Vendors Needed for Charles County’s First Environmental Summit

The Charles County Commissioners recently announced a kick off of Earth Week 2010 with the first “Charles County Going Green Summit”.

Charles County’s Going Green Summit will be held April 17, 2010 from 10:00 a.m. until 4:00 p.m. at North Point High School in Waldorf. This new event is FREE and open to the public.
